On a scale drawing with a scale of 1 cm = 0.9 m, the height of a tree is 1.2 cm. How tall is the actual tree in meters?
Irina-Kira [14]
1cm=.9m
we can multiply this by 1.2 because it will help when solving the equation
1.2cm=1.08m 
this is your answer!
